What is the full form of DARE?

💡

Correct Answer: A. Department of Agricultural Research and Education

DARE stands for Department of Agricultural Research and Education under the Ministry of Agriculture. DARE has administrative control over ICAR and coordinates agricultural research and education. The Secretary of DARE also serves as the Director General of ICAR, creating unified leadership for agricultural research.

National Rural Infrastructure Development Agency (NRIDA) is related to:

💡

Correct Answer: B. Rural roads under PMGSY

NRIDA (National Rural Infrastructure Development Agency) oversees implementation of Pradhan Mantri Gram Sadak Yojana (PMGSY) for rural road connectivity. Rural roads are critical for agricultural development as they connect farms to markets and reduce transportation costs. Better connectivity helps farmers access larger markets and get better prices.

What is the rate of interest subvention provided for short-term crop loans?

💡

Correct Answer: B. 2%

The government provides 2% interest subvention for short-term crop loans up to ₹3 lakh at 7% interest rate. This reduces the effective interest rate to 5% for all farmers. Additionally, prompt repayment incentive of 3% is provided, reducing the rate further to 4% for farmers who repay within the prescribed time.

Pradhan Mantri Micro Food Processing Enterprises Scheme focuses on:

💡

Correct Answer: B. Formalizing and upgrading micro food processing enterprises

PM Micro Food Processing Enterprises (PM FME) scheme focuses on formalizing and upgrading micro food processing enterprises in the unorganized sector. It provides financial, technical, and business support to existing micro enterprises. The scheme promotes FPO-based common infrastructure and branding for collective benefits.

Which scheme integrates all agricultural extension services at the district level?

💡

Correct Answer: B. ATMA

ATMA (Agricultural Technology Management Agency) integrates all agricultural extension services at the district level. It brings together research (KVK), extension (line departments), and farmer organizations in a single coordination platform. ATMA was created to ensure that latest agricultural technologies reach farmers efficiently through a unified extension system.

Under PM-KISAN, which installment covers the December-March period?

💡

Correct Answer: C. Third installment

Under PM-KISAN, the third installment covers the December to March period. The first installment covers April to July, and the second covers August to November. These three four-monthly installments together make up the annual ₹6,000 benefit to eligible farmer families.

National Mission for Protein Supplements aims to increase production of:

💡

Correct Answer: B. Pulses, fish, meat, and milk

National Mission for Protein Supplements (NMPS) aims to increase production of protein-rich foods including pulses, fish, meat, eggs, and milk. Protein deficiency is a significant nutritional challenge in India. The mission supports development of aquaculture, poultry, small ruminants, and pulse production.

Which state is known as the 'rice bowl of India'?

💡

Correct Answer: C. Andhra Pradesh

Andhra Pradesh (including present-day Telangana) is known as the 'Rice Bowl of India' due to its high production of rice in Krishna-Godavari delta. Punjab and Haryana are known as 'Granary of India' for wheat production. West Bengal is the largest producer of rice by volume in India.

Under eNAM, what happens to the quality testing of produce?

💡

Correct Answer: B. Assaying (quality testing) is done at mandi before online bidding

Under eNAM, assaying or quality testing of agricultural produce is done at the mandi before online bidding starts. The quality parameters are uploaded on the platform so that buyers can make informed bids. This transparent quality disclosure system is key to the success of the online trading platform.

What is the main objective of Integrated Scheme for Agricultural Marketing?

💡

Correct Answer: B. Development of marketing infrastructure and promotion of direct marketing

Integrated Scheme for Agricultural Marketing (ISAM) aims to develop marketing infrastructure, promote grading and standardization, and support direct marketing. It includes assistance for construction of rural primary markets, wholesale markets, and farmers' markets. The scheme promotes farmer-consumer linkage to reduce intermediary margins.
